Building a post and rail fence is a popular choice for homeowners who want to add a rustic and charming touch to their property. This type of fence, also known as a split rail fence, consists of horizontal wooden rails supported by vertical wooden posts. It offers an open and natural look that blends well with various landscapes.

The standard for post placement is 6-8′. We decided on 8′ so that each 16′ rail would end up being fastened to, and spanning three posts. This allowed for better stability with no butted joints. Run a string line to indicate the fence perimeter and mark 8′ apart where the holes will go.

Split rail fence was originally designed to keep large farm animals contained. Because if its open design, having large spaces between the rails, smaller animals pass through it easily. However, split rail fence with wire attached to it eliminates large gaps and spaces. As result, giving it the ability to contain pets and small farm animals.

One of the most rustic fence designs, strongly representative of the simple country life, split rail fencing is composed of just that: two or three split rails, inserted into two equally rough-finished wooden posts. The posts are secured in the ground with or without concrete.
